Financial Wellness Benefits Market Overview and Detailed Report Coverage
Financial wellness benefits encompass employee assistance programs that promote financial literacy, management, and planning. The market size has seen significant growth, driven by an increasing recognition of financial stress impacting employee productivity. Growth opportunities lie in personalized solutions and technology-driven platforms. Key industry trends include the integration of mental health support and enhanced digital tools to engage employees. The competitive landscape features a mix of traditional providers and emerging fintech startups. Who Dominates the Market for Financial Wellness Benefits?
The Financial Wellness Benefits Market is increasingly shaped by numerous key players offering varied services aimed at improving employees' financial health. Major companies in this sector include Prudential Financial, Bank of America, Fidelity, and Mercer, each providing comprehensive financial planning tools, educational resources, and personalized services.
Prudential Financial emphasizes insurance and investment education, while Bank of America integrates banking services into its financial wellness offerings. Fidelity provides retirement planning and investment guidance, whereas Mercer focuses on employee benefits consulting, helping organizations implement effective wellness programs.
Additionally, companies like Hellowallet, LearnVest, and SmartDollar offer technology-driven solutions for personalized financial advice, thereby enhancing employee engagement and participation. Aduro, Ayco, and Beacon Health Options focus on holistic wellness, integrating financial health with overall employee well-being.
Market share analysis indicates that larger firms dominate due to their extensive resources, broad service ranges, and established reputations, while smaller firms carve niches through specialized offerings.

Impact of COVID-19 on the Financial Wellness Benefits Market
The COVID-19 pandemic has significantly impacted the Financial Wellness Benefits market, disrupting supply chains that deliver these services and leading to increased demand as employees seek support amid economic uncertainty. Employers are prioritizing financial wellness programs to address employee stress and retention. The market faced volatility due to fluctuating economic conditions, prompting organizations to reassess their benefits offerings. Additionally, the focus on remote work and digital solutions has led to innovations in financial wellness products, emphasizing accessibility and adaptability in response to evolving employee needs during and post-pandemic.
